• Bug#1059647: scikit-fmm: autopkgtest failure with Python 3.12

    From Graham Inggs@21:1/5 to All on Fri Dec 29 20:10:01 2023
    Source: scikit-fmm
    Version: 2022.08.15-4
    Severity: serious
    User: debian-python@lists.debian.org
    Usertags: python3.12

    Hi Maintainer

    scikit-fmm's autopkgtests fail with Python 3.12 [1]. I've copied what
    I hope is the relevant part of the log below.

    Regards
    Graham


    [1] https://ci.debian.net/packages/s/scikit-fmm/testing/amd64/


    35s autopkgtest [20:09:41]: test command1: - - - - - - - - - -
    results - - - - - - - - - -
    35s command1 FAIL stderr: <frozen
    importlib._bootstrap>:488: RuntimeWarning: compiletime version 3.11 of
    module 'skfmm.pheap' does not match runtime version 3.12
    35s autopkgtest [20:09:41]: test command1: - - - - - - - - - -
    stderr - - - - - - - - - -
    35s <frozen importlib._bootstrap>:488: RuntimeWarning: compiletime
    version 3.11 of module 'skfmm.pheap' does not match runtime version
    3.12

    --- SoupGate-Win32 v1.05
    * Origin: fsxNet Usenet Gateway (21:1/5)
  • From Bdale Garbee@21:1/5 to Graham Inggs on Sat Feb 17 18:30:02 2024
    tags 1059647 +help
    thanks

    Graham Inggs <ginggs@debian.org> writes:

    Source: scikit-fmm
    Version: 2022.08.15-4
    Severity: serious
    User: debian-python@lists.debian.org
    Usertags: python3.12

    Hi Maintainer

    scikit-fmm's autopkgtests fail with Python 3.12 [1]. I've copied what
    I hope is the relevant part of the log below.

    It looks like upstream may not be ready for use with Python 3.12, at
    least in part due to numpy.distutils disappearing. There is an open
    issue about this at

    https://github.com/scikit-fmm/scikit-fmm/issues/78

    Since upstream doesn't seem to have a fix yet, fixing the Debian package
    may require someone who understands what's going on offering to help fix
    the upstream code.

    Bdale

    --=-=-Content-Type: application/pgp-signature; name="signature.asc"

    -----BEGIN PGP SIGNATURE-----

    iQIzBAEBCgAdFiEEHguq2FwiMqGzzpLrtwRxBYMLn6EFAmXQ6kwACgkQtwRxBYML n6EHkhAA00aeU7X1KH7mxzxLw5y9cqYm3hlw0iRW9Vhqr1bjt2foBb4wjh3Jb040 vft/UHK6j0yYzl0LcAgiZLTA+XO7qff9iOq+r+JWf6G4XSPMUPmm6XLy0HbQS/ga QHkPsrzwbqUD/lIA/bQ3oS32/hjyEVwa67GQbaXZjYrGjccl5G7X3sJgMpuBtAce hYu7eKMBALA8guppBKFTD8+0Wa2LECZnSZWEJ6tKE+TSWEk17D9ELFgJ7JHr6Vzb du11fwvU4AkZ9/gw0Mgtgq/cGcEagyQSXHFoEJ/Hj6gP7djsO463yzfBO1UCZX3D pcTZDMlVt2d5Lb+o5iHot+xRoF9Qe6J5c32RMe3gioLaGfGaCW8uGwnKM7IC2Znd Pipai1UbArKXHkaY1ukI2uB/LNFtUsAP9jOsHt5KAruAtZFLK69SH53bJMWhWYBY ilXat2+OUfOtqRTf4FpFhggW32e2LxxS+c+iuQ+U9gqUTycsbEruomRHkJYFZv8e 2h0GZ6AAAaaPRUvTaVMsS3cjgLzY7CAot13Jq5xzl7w4XJZEs7zIia3I3+PogQk/ kitmqqwLqZ1mMxKqLYUVCBgQHvwL54oeWQ+ry4NHm71wplHBq7uhmKSTG5Q00Wyw S7Ql5ARhmWR3sOxKSY1/kcR1uVCBazL8FZQxu7Tlsh+hO44ENas=0qXC
    -----END PGP SIGNATURE-----

    --- SoupGate-Win32 v1.05
    * Origin: fsxNet Usenet Gateway (21:1/5)